Pinnacle Group Cleaner Role
Pinnacle Group is seeking a dedicated Cleaner to maintain high standards of cleanliness and hygiene in our communities. You will be joining our Soft FM Cleaning teams based on sites across Tower Hamlets.
About the Role
Our Soft Facilities Management division delivers essential services to homes, schools, universities, and public sector organisations – including housing providers and blue light authorities. We focus on creating clean, safe, and welcoming environments, with a commitment to quality, community impact, and customer care.
This position will involve traveling to numerous community centers across the Tower Hamlets area. The cleaner will be responsible for ensuring that all areas in the centers are cleaned to the highest standard. The sites will need to be visited in line with set schedules, to ensure all properties are cleaned within the measured period. Alongside the set cleaning schedule, the operative will also be expected to complete ad hoc cleaning tasks as required.
Key Responsibilities Will Include
- Cleaning of multiple sites within a scheme.
- Cleaning of internal/external glazing (up to 2.5m).
- Ensure that internal communal areas and facilities are clean, hygienic, and free from litter, bulky refuse, and health and safety risks.
- To keep the equipment clean and damage-free, report to the manager when necessary.
- Care and maintenance of company vehicle and reporting any damage or defects.
- Use of Job Watch (Smart Phone based) to carry out the jobs every day.

Key Requirements
- Full UK Driving Licence.
- Strong cleaning experience.
- Knowledge of the use of chemicals (COSHH) and Health and Safety legislation is desirable.
